The first step in selecting the right ODM custom power adapter is to clearly define your device's power requirements. Assess the voltage and current specifications needed for optimal operation. Ensure the adapter can deliver sufficient power without causing damage to your device. Consulting with your engineering team can help clarify these needs, and it's always advisable to allow for a safety margin when defining your specifications.
Regulatory compliance is crucial for power adapters, especially if your products will be sold internationally. Check for certifications such as UL, CE, and RoHS to ensure the ODM custom power adapter adheres to necessary safety and environmental standards. These certifications not only help in legal compliance but also reassure customers regarding product safety and reliability.
The design of a power adapter should align not only with technical requirements but also with the aesthetics of your product. Consider the size, weight, and form factor of the ODM custom power adapter. It should blend seamlessly with your device design and should be user-friendly. Additionally, think about whether you need a compact form or a more robust design based on how the adapter will be used.
Choosing an experienced ODM manufacturer can significantly impact the success of your project. Research their track record, capabilities, and customer feedback. A reputable manufacturer will understand the nuances of power adapter design and production, helping you avoid common pitfalls. They should offer a range of customization options, allowing you to adapt the product to your specific needs without compromising quality.

While budgeting is an important aspect of your procurement process, it shouldn't come at the expense of quality. The lowest price often leads to subpar performance, reliability issues, and shorter lifespans. Evaluate the cost against the quality and features offered. A premium ODM custom power adapter may have a higher upfront cost but can lead to lower total cost of ownership through reduced failure rates and extended lifespan.
Consider the lead times associated with the ODM custom power adapter manufacturers. Understanding their production timelines will help with your project planning. In addition, assess the level of customer support provided. A responsive manufacturer is essential for addressing any inquiries or concerns throughout the development process, ensuring that you stay on track and achieve your deadlines.
Once you’ve selected a potential ODM custom power adapter, ensure extensive testing is conducted before full-scale production. This phase should include performance testing under various conditions to validate that the adapter meets your specifications and safety standards. This process minimizes risks and allows for adjustments before final production.
